MySQL Error number: MY-012255; Symbol: ER_IB_MSG_430; SQLSTATE: HY000

文档解释

Error number: MY-012255; Symbol: ER_IB_MSG_430; SQLSTATE: HY000

Message: %s

错误说明:

MySQL ER_IB_MSG_430错误是由MySQL提供的一个常见的客户端连接错误。该错误指出MySQL不能完成要求的操作,通常是由于客户端库代码无法与服务器建立或维持连接所引起的,具体原因与客户端库版本之间的不兼容有关,包括操作系统版本(或子系统)、MySQL版本或客户端库版本。

常见案例

ER_IB_MSG_430 错误常见的情况是在发生预期的超时时尝试连接服务器。例如,当MySQL Server正在不停止地运行,并且使用default-time-zone参数设置默认时区(例如America/Los_Angeles),此时客户端机器的时间超过America/Los_Angeles的时区的最大值(例如 PST/PDT),会出现该错误。

解决方法:

ER_IB_MSG_430 错误的最常用解决方案就是在MySQL服务器上解决问题。首先,你需要确保客户端库版本与服务器版本之间兼容。其次,你需要验证是否将服务器时间设置为正确的时常(For example, PST/PDT),确保客户端机器也总时间也正确设置。此外,需要检查正在使用的用户和数据库权限是否合乎预期,这可能会影响建立连接的能力。当然,你也可以尝试重新启动MySQL服务,这往往能够解决问题。最后,如果无法解决上述问题,你可以尝试升级MySQL服务器,这对于解决某些版本不兼容的问题往往有效。

你可能感兴趣的